24.0.19 (4/29/2018)

1. Fixed: Tooltip box shadows were offsetting the text below the shadow.
2. NEW: Text edit boxes now have a more convenient way to add Latin characters with diacritics.  Press and hold a letter key and a list of choices with diacritical versions for that letter is shown to choose from.
3. Fixed: On ARM the non-sse bilinear rendering wasn't properly handling the alpha channel resulting in some see through icons.

24.0.18 (4/24/2018)

1. Changed: Updated FFmpeg to version 4.0, used for file analysis, transcoding and video playback.
2. Changed: Optimized Video rendering image uploading for better performance and reliability.

24.0.16 (4/17/2018)

1. FIXED: A significant memory leak.

24.0.15 (4/13/2018)

1. NEW: Added support for bilinear image resizing (on ARM which didn't have it before) so that images in the program will look much better.
2. Fixed: A segfault upon startup with systems that have non-standard /dev tree.

24.0.12 (4/10/2018)

1. Fixed: Non-Root users on linux couldn't send WOL packets.
2. Fixed: Removed unsupported print commands from menus.
3. NEW: Much faster FFT code for places where spectrum analysis is used.
4. Changed: Some licensing code. Registration code will need to be re-entered.

24.0.2 (02/03/2018)

1. NEW: First MC24 build for linux
